Skip to content

Conversation

@gfortaine
Copy link
Collaborator

Description

Update the legal notice dialog ("Mention légale") with the new text as requested in GitLab issue gestion-de-projet#3163.

Changes

The legal mention text has been updated according to the requirements:

Before

  • Only mentioned compliance with CME health data access rules
  • Data collected: date, time, action type
  • Data retained for 3 years in DSI log files
  • Contact: [email protected]

After

  • Mentions compliance with CME health data access rules
  • New: Also mentions compliance with usage rules accepted during user training
  • Data collected: date, time, action type, APH, name, first name, email, authorization scope
  • Data retained for the strictly necessary duration for its purpose
  • DPO contact: [email protected]
  • New: Support contact: [email protected]
  • Added align="justify" to all paragraphs for better readability

Verification

  1. Start the application locally
  2. Go to the login page
  3. Click on "En vous connectant, vous acceptez la mention légale" link
  4. Verify the legal mention dialog displays the updated text

Screenshots

N/A - Text-only change


Fixes: gestion-de-projet#3163

Update the legal notice dialog with the new text as requested:
- Add paragraph about training rules compliance
- Update data collection details (APH, name, first name, email, authorization scope)
- Update data retention period wording
- Change DPO email from [email protected] to [email protected]
- Add support contact email: [email protected]
- Add align="justify" to all DialogContentText components
@gfortaine gfortaine force-pushed the fix/update-legal-mention-text branch 4 times, most recently from 6cc4cd2 to a3e7705 Compare January 8, 2026 02:07
@gfortaine gfortaine force-pushed the fix/update-legal-mention-text branch from a3e7705 to 3f4fceb Compare January 8, 2026 02:35
@aetchego aetchego merged commit 42c4832 into main Jan 9, 2026
4 of 5 checks passed
@aetchego aetchego deleted the fix/update-legal-mention-text branch January 9, 2026 12:58
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ants